Transaction 18e2dc37e83011ddc23d57676b760386d07f84352b69f7bdb7606da45eb71024
1 Input
1 Output
-
18e2dc37e83011ddc23d57676b760386d07f84352b69f7bdb7606da45eb71024:0
- value
- 2581660948089
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 048f469964a1890c30d51603c4db2ff4040aa7bfc34727b1e69004710180a5de
- address
- ltc1gqj85dxty5xyscvx4zcpufke07szq4falcdrj0v0xjqz8zqvq5h0qy2qyc6